Chronological but not functional aging of giant fiber (GF) descending neuron dendrite structure. Top left: Representative 3-D reconstruction of GF dendritic structure color-coded for the different dendritic domains that receive input from different modalities. The visual input dendrite is coded in red. Bottom left: Representative 3-D reconstruction of GF dendrites at the age of 3 (left) vs. 5 weeks (right). Right: Representative reconstruction of GF dendrites during chronological aging between weeks 7 and 11 from animals that show visually induced escape behavior (left column, responders) as compared to age-matched animas not showing visually induced escape behavior (right column, NRs).

Age-related decline is restricted to specific #neuron types & #brain regions. This study shows components of the #Drosophila escape motor circuit vary in susceptibility to #aging & stressors, with plastic components being vulnerable & hard-wired components robust @plosbiology.org 🧪 plos.io/45gobl9

Harvard Funding Cuts Endanger the Massive Fruit Fly Database That Powers Genetic Research | News | The Harvard Crimson FlyBase lost a multimillion dollar grant when the Trump administration cut off Harvard’s federal funding in May. Now the repository is laying off staff — and researchers worldwide are worried.

Juvenile hormone regulates the maturation of sexually dimorphic naive ethanol olfactory preference in Drosophila melanogaster | Royal Society Open Science The molecular mechanisms underlying the maturation of innate reward behaviours remain poorly understood. We have identified a sexually dimorphic innate reward behaviour in Drosophila melanogaster that varies depending on the age, sex and mating status in ...

Giant study finds a research field that’s mostly reproducible Researchers assessed more than 1,000 results from fruit-fly immunity research published between 1959 and 2011. The majority of findings look verifiable.
